Whispers in the Shadows: A Dark Blood Revelation
In the heart of a forgotten village, nestled among the ancient trees and whispering winds, lived a young woman named Elara. Her life was as ordinary as the dust that settled on the cobblestone streets, until the night her grandmother passed away, leaving behind a cryptic note that would change everything.
The note spoke of a dark bloodline, a curse that had plagued her family for generations. It spoke of shadows and whispers, of a darkness that could not be banished, and of a truth that was too terrible to face. But Elara, driven by an inexplicable sense of urgency, knew she could not ignore the call of the past.
As she delved deeper into her family's history, Elara discovered that her grandmother had been a guardian of a hidden truth, a truth that had been kept secret for centuries. The village was not as peaceful as it appeared; it was a facade, a mask covering a much darker reality.
The whispers she heard at night grew louder, more insistent, calling her name and urging her to uncover the truth. Her friends and family, once her closest allies, began to distance themselves, suspecting her madness or, worse, her complicity in the curse.
Elara's journey led her to the edge of the village, where the trees grew wild and the ground was littered with the remnants of an ancient battle. There, she found an old, abandoned church, its windows shattered and its doors locked against the encroaching darkness. Inside, she discovered a series of cryptic symbols, each one a clue to the truth she sought.
As she deciphered the symbols, Elara realized that the curse was not just a family secret; it was a prophecy, a warning that the world was on the brink of a great darkness. The whispers were not just her own fears; they were the voices of the cursed, calling out for release.
In a desperate bid to end the curse, Elara made a deal with the shadows, offering her own soul in exchange for the freedom of her family and the world. The deal was struck, and the shadows responded, banishing the curse but leaving Elara forever entwined with the darkness.
The village was saved, but Elara's life was forever altered. She became the guardian of the dark bloodline, a sentinel against the encroaching darkness. The whispers grew quieter, but they never stopped, reminding her of the price she had paid and the burden she carried.
One evening, as the village was enveloped in the longest night of the year, Elara stood on the hilltop, watching the stars fade into darkness. She whispered to the shadows, "I will protect you, as you have protected us. But know this, I will never forget the cost."
And so, Elara lived in the shadows, her heart heavy with the weight of her sacrifice, her eyes forever searching for the light that had been lost to the darkness. The whispers continued, a constant reminder of the truth she had uncovered and the world she had saved, at a terrible cost.
The end.
